Hercco
I'm a fan of Irfanview too. Actually with plugins it is lot more than just an image viewer. Heck it can play mp3's, show video and do operations to images. And still it is ultralight as an image viewer has to be for quick loading and shut down.

Sarah81
I use FastStone Image Viewer when I actually want to make quick changes (cropping, taking out the red-eye, adjusting contrast/colors/etc.)...but when I just want to look at the pic, I use the XP viewer.

And I like the FastStone thing because it's free (check download.com) and works really well for the basic stuff that I do. (Not a graphic artist - just want my digital pix to look decent.)

But when I really want to get creative, I go to my school's digital lab and use their copy of Paint Shop Pro (because I can't justify buying my own copy).

miCRoSCoPiC^eaRthLinG
You guys should try using Picassa too. I've got both IrfanView and Picassa installed, and Picassa of late has evolved into a really powerful viewer + picture cataloging & maintainance software. ACDSee used to be my favourite till maybe version 5. After that it's become really bulky and quite unstable too.
